eSpeak
eSpeak

Description: eSpeak is an open source software speech synthesizer for Linux, Windows, and other platforms. It supports many languages and accents and is customizable. eSpeak converts text to speech with good quality and versatility.

eSpeak
eSpeak
Pros
  • Free and open source
  • Good quality voice output
  • Lightweight and fast
  • Highly customizable
  • Supports many languages
Cons
  • Computerized, robotic sounding voice
  • Limited natural sounding intonation
  • Can sound unnatural at higher speeds
  • Lacks some advanced text-to-speech features
